Why sealcoat?

Asphalt takes a beating from man and nature. Chemicals, gasoline, oil and other compounds soften and destroy the binder in asphalt. Sunlight, water, and oxygen attack the surface as soon as it's installed. In time the asphalt loses its flexibility; the aggregate stone loosens. The surface becomes porous and rough. Grime and dirt become highly noticeable. Pavement sealer is your protection against most damaging elements that man or nature has install for your asphalt surface. As its name says, pavement sealer seals the binder in and seals destructive elements out.

What about the cracks?

Cracks are an invitation to moisture and harmful chemicals to seep into the pavement's base and ruin your driveway. As this moisture expands and freezes, the pavement will break and the driveway will fail. To prevent this, we install a high-quality, hot applied crack and joint sealant to your cracks before seal coating. Although this crack fill is visible, the sealed cracks prevent moisture for causing further damage. The crack filling is NOT included in the sealcoat price.

After seal coating, when can I park on my driveway? 

Dry times for sealcoat depend greatly on the exposure to the sun and temperatures. In most cases, you can walk and drive on the driveway within 24 hours after seal coating. .

When is the best time of year to sealcoat?

Seal coating must be performed when the temperature is about 50 degrees over night. This means that the best time to sealcoat is between the months of April and October.


When I park on my driveway, why do tire marks appear?

Because the sealcoat takes time to fully cure, tire marks sometimes appear 1 to 2 weeks after the sealcoat is applied, especially during humid summer months. After the sealcoat cures, the tire marks will disappear.
